In enhancement to level measurement and pressure picking up, flow measurement plays a crucial duty in industrial processes. Inline flow meters are among the most generally used gadgets, measuring the quantity or mass of fluids and gases moving via a pipe. Magnetic flow meters, which utilize Faraday’s Law of electro-magnetic induction, provide a non-invasive approach of flow measurement with no moving components, making them a preferred selection for applications including conductive liquids. Their precision and reliability in gauging water flow and other fluids have actually made them vital devices in numerous sectors, consisting of water food, drink and therapy, and chemical processing. Enhancing these innovations, clamp-on ultrasonic flow meters offer a non-intrusive method of flow measurement by clamping onto the beyond a pipeline. This approach not just lowers installation costs but additionally minimizes the demand for maintenance, thus boosting the total performance of flow measurement systems.

Technological developments have likewise presented guided wave radar level transmitters, which are specifically effective in challenging atmospheres. These sensors use radar technology to measure degrees within a tank, giving boosted accuracy and integrity, specifically for applications with varying densities or conditions that can otherwise prevent measurement precision. Hydrostatic level sensors offer an additional technique for level measurement, using pressure to gauge fluid height based upon the hydrostatic pressure applied by the liquid above the sensor. This approach is commonly used in water management and wastewater treatment facilities, where comprehending liquid levels is essential for functional efficiency.
